    Abstract: A case to hold spare ammunition magazines for a machine pistol. The case includes a pocket dimensioned to accommodate at least two magazines with the left side of one facing the right side of the other, and with the flange end of each protruding from the pocket. The case has a first strap that can be closed to cover the protruding flange end of the first magazine, and a second strap than can be closed to cover the protruding flange end of the second magazine. The second strap has a set back portion of its inner edge such that when the first strap is opened, the second strap allows greater access to the protruding end of the first magazine. The case also has a divider that separates the pocket into two portions, one to accommodate each magazine, and that provides a gap between the protruding ends of the magazines.

    Abstract: A manual transmission comprises a primary shaft and first and second secondary shafts placed parallel with the primary shaft. First speed, second speed, fifth speed and reverse idling gears are rotatably mounted on the first secondary shaft. A first double synchronizer is mounted on the first secondary shaft between the first speed idling gear and the second speed idling gear. A second double synchronizer is mounted on the first secondary shaft between the fifth speed idling gear and the reverse idling gear. Third and fourth speed idling gears are rotatably mounted on the second secondary shaft. A third double synchronizer is mounted on the second secondary shaft between the third speed idling gear and the fourth speed idling gear. A third speed gear is mounted on the primary shaft and meshes with the third speed idling gear, the third speed gear being axially positioned between the teeth of the reverse idling gear and the second double synchronizer.
